Transaction 701f00814c72aead812716561ea9d8a05b7a89348fc7c4eaf7a564ece9688802
1 Input
1 Output
-
701f00814c72aead812716561ea9d8a05b7a89348fc7c4eaf7a564ece9688802:0
- value
- 2677947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ef535a4c001d06cb0577ddae66c9dab2d67af58e OP_EQUAL
- address
- 3PWTGqfecMiS5Ti3QJaFQxQfKNbd9DetMi